Flea beetles on winter linseed a

Winter linseed is not affected by any flea beetle. Cabbage stem flea beetle, clue is in the name, only see on brassica or cabbage family plants. Flax Flea beetle only affects spring linseed. The flax flea beetle needs linseed cotelydons to eat when it emerges in spring/summer, the winter linseed is too big by this point to be a target.
